From 1aba073e32e70c629ab73bc3dbe9a94e50234669 Mon Sep 17 00:00:00 2001 From: Norman Feske Date: Tue, 20 Dec 2022 12:05:01 +0100 Subject: [PATCH] vfs: remove File_io_service::General_error Issue #4706 --- repos/os/include/vfs/file_io_service.h |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) diff --git a/repos/os/include/vfs/file_io_service.h b/repos/os/include/vfs/file_io_service.h index c71712eb7c..596cb78343 100644 --- a/repos/os/include/vfs/file_io_service.h +++ b/repos/os/include/vfs/file_io_service.h @@ -23,9 +23,6 @@ namespace Vfs { struct File_io_service; } struct Vfs::File_io_service : Interface { - enum General_error { ERR_FD_INVALID, NUM_GENERAL_ERRORS }; - - /*********** ** Write ** ***********/ @@ -89,9 +86,8 @@ struct Vfs::File_io_service : Interface ** Ftruncate ** ***************/ - enum Ftruncate_result { FTRUNCATE_ERR_NO_PERM = NUM_GENERAL_ERRORS, - FTRUNCATE_ERR_INTERRUPT, FTRUNCATE_ERR_NO_SPACE, - FTRUNCATE_OK }; + enum Ftruncate_result { FTRUNCATE_ERR_NO_PERM, FTRUNCATE_ERR_INTERRUPT, + FTRUNCATE_ERR_NO_SPACE, FTRUNCATE_OK }; virtual Ftruncate_result ftruncate(Vfs_handle *vfs_handle, file_size len) = 0;